Elkhorn Mountain Inn
AuthenticatedHotels and ResortsGet Direction
Elkhorn Mountain Inn
AuthenticatedHotels and ResortsGet Direction
Overview
Reviews
Faq’s
About
Elkhorn Mountain Inn
AuthenticatedHotels and ResortsGet Direction
Looking for Monthly Hotel Rooms in Helena MT?
At Elkhorn Mountain Inn- Extended Stay, we pride ourselves on providing exceptional service and creating a warm, inviting atmosphere for our guests. Relax and let us cater to your every need during your stay. Visit our website to know more!